Travel Tips

  • ⛰ Plan for Scenic Views

    Flights from Zihuatanejo to Puerto Vallarta often offer breathtaking coastal and mountain views. Make sure to grab a window seat to take in the stunning landscapes of the Sierra Madre mountains and the Pacific coastline during your flight.

  • 📍 Language Considerations

    While many people in Puerto Vallarta speak English, it’s helpful to know a few basic Spanish phrases. This gesture is appreciated and can enhance your interactions with locals upon arrival, as Puerto Vallarta is steeped in rich Mexican culture.

  • 🚍 Pack Light and Smart

    Given that the flight is relatively short, consider packing light. Use a carry-on to avoid checked baggage fees and expedite your travel. Be sure to include essentials like sunscreen and a reusable water bottle to stay hydrated upon arrival.

  • 🎭 Respecting Local Customs

    When traveling to Puerto Vallarta, familiarize yourself with local customs, such as greetings and dining etiquette. A simple 'buenos dĂ­as' (good morning) can go a long way in establishing rapport with the locals.

  • 🏛 Check Flight and Weather Updates

    Weather can vary greatly in this region, so keep an eye on flight updates and local forecasts. Packing accordingly for both warm beach weather and cooler mountain evenings will enhance your travel experience.
